2012-06-27 50 views
1

有誰有一些想法,爲什麼應用網頁,雖然它是確定在PC(包括Safari)

https://www.facebook.com/balconi.cz/app_329635017093632https://apps.facebook.com/posli-dortik-balconi/

未在的Mac OS看? 那裏完全是空白頁。

它不是,也沒有在Safari瀏覽器也沒有在Mac上的FF運行。 但是在PC上的所有常見瀏覽器都可以,包括Safari。

編輯:我不使用任何閃光那裏,所以閃光燈是不是理由。

+0

我投票關閉這一問題作爲題外話,因爲它無關的編程。 – royhowie

+0

所以把它移動到正確的線程,我什至不知道它現在在哪個主題。 –

回答

0

它不爲我工作在Windows,無論是。

那是因爲你想顯示身份驗證對話框中的一個iframe中 - 其中Facebook並沒有允許(除非你已經有一個訪問令牌和對話網址內提供的話)。他們發送一個HTTP響應頭文件,說這個頁面不應該顯示在iframe中,現代瀏覽器會尊重這個頭文件。

使用JavaScript頂部窗口重定向到身份驗證對話框的地址:

top.location.href = "…{url}…"; 
+0

非常感謝,它已經解決了這個問題。 –